Oracle数据库究竟隐藏了什么?
在今天的信息化社会中,数据库已经成为了各个企业中不可或缺的信息基础设施之一。其中,Oracle数据库更是备受各大企业的青睐,其性能表现和稳定性是众所周知的。但事实上,Oracle数据库里面还储藏着很多神秘的东西。那么,Oracle数据库究竟隐藏了什么?
隐藏用户
Oracle数据库支持隐藏用户,这些用户只能通过数据库管理员的特殊权限来访问。这些用户在正常情况下是不能通过常规的登录方式进入数据库的。这种隐藏用户可以用于特殊应用请求,比如备份和出现安全问题时。
隐藏表
Oracle数据库还支持隐藏一些不需要访问的表,不需要访问的表对于数据库性能的提升也具有一定的作用。隐藏的表是无法通过普通的SELECT语句查出来的,在应用程序中需要特别的操作才能访问这些隐藏的表格。
隐藏列
除了隐藏用户和表以外,Oracle数据库还支持隐藏列。这种隐藏列只是对于特殊的用户可以查看到。这种方式可以有效地保护重要信息,避免信息泄漏的风险。
隐藏程序
Oracle数据库中的存储过程、触发器等对象,我们还可以隐藏他们,只有特定的权限组或客户端可以访问。这种方式一般用于保护程序的安全性和专有性,采用这种方式可以防止有黑客借助存储过程等程序工具对系统进行攻击。
Oracle数据库具有很强的安全性和机密性,其隐藏的功能并没有公开,需要数据库管理员通过特殊的授权和权限才能访问和使用。对于企业来说,更好地掌握这些隐藏的功能,会对加强数据库的安全性和稳定性大有裨益。
除了上面这些,Oracle数据库还有很多未知的隐藏功能,这些功能还有待进一步开发和发掘。不过我们需要注意的是,不要滥用这些隐藏功能,否则可能会导致系统的不稳定以及安全隐患。